ADA/Section 504 Coordinator. DCF shall ensure that DCF’s Civil Rights Officers serve as ADA/Section 504 Coordinators to implement the terms of this Agreement within each DCF Administrative Office, DCF Region, and throughout the state by overseeing DCF’s network of Single-Point-of-Contacts for delivering services to deaf or hard-of-hearing Customers or Companions seeking services from each DCF Direct Service Facility. [These Single-Point-of-Contacts typically are DCF’s approximate one-hundred and ten (110) Operations Program Administrators (“OPA”) or their designees.] Within fifteen (15) calendar days of the Effective Date of this Agreement, DCF shall submit to OCR for approval the name and contact information for each ADA/Section 504 Coordinator. These ADA/Section 504 Coordinators shall ensure the provision of auxiliary aids and services for deaf or heard-of-hearing Customers or Companions by accomplishing the following actions without limitation:
ADA/Section 504 Coordinator. DVR will distribute a notice to current clients, DVR staff, and members of the public regarding the identity, contact information, and extent of authority of the agency’s ADA / Section 504 Coordinator who handles non-employment matters. After DVR transitions to the Colorado Department of Labor and Employment (CDLE),1 DVR will distribute an updated notice as necessary. Reporting Provision (3)(a). By February 12, 2016, DVR will describe to OCR with specificity how, where, and to whom the clarification has been distributed, posted, and publicized. DVR will make a similar report to OCR within thirty (30) days after its transition to CDLE.

Within 14 days of the effective date of this Consent Agreement, DTSC and Respondent shall each designate a Project Coordinator and shall notify each other in writing of the Project Coordinator selected. Each Project Coordinator shall be responsible for overseeing the implementation of this Consent Agreement and for designating a person to act in his/her absence. All communications between Respondent and DTSC, and all documents, report approvals, and other correspondence concerning the activities performed pursuant to this Consent Agreement shall be directed through the Project Coordinators. Each party may change its Project Coordinator with at least seven days prior written notice. WORK TO BE PERFORMED
